Output 3e50c88f72174c313564a0fd7e67367248e7cddda64e2ac3c18a8c5e01d22dd5:1

value
28779
script pubkey
OP_0 OP_PUSHBYTES_20 095b9cf075141451a118667d4e982a43aa2d9239
address
bc1qp9deeur4zs29rggcve75axp2gw4zmy3enfwj9s
transaction
3e50c88f72174c313564a0fd7e67367248e7cddda64e2ac3c18a8c5e01d22dd5
confirmations
109260
spent
true